For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 90 students in Animas School District. This district's average high testing ranking is 7/10, which is in the top 50% of public high schools in New Mexico.
Public High School in Animas School District have an average math proficiency score of 24% (versus the New Mexico public high school average of 21%), and reading proficiency score of 45% (versus the 35% statewide average).
Public High School in Animas School District have a Graduation Rate of 80%, which is more than the New Mexico average of 76%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Animas 7-12 School, with ≥80%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in New Mexico or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 40%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the New Mexico public high school average of 81%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$18,273 is higher than the state median of $15,107. The school district revenue/student has declined by 16%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$18,176 is higher than the state median of $14,456. The school district spending/student has declined by 10% over four school years.
